Grassroots fundraising involves mobilizing a large number of individual donors to contribute small amounts of money, rather than relying on a few wealthy donors for large contributions.

One of the key trends in grassroots fundraising initiatives for political campaigns is the use of online platforms and social media to reach potential donors. Platforms like ActBlue and CrowdPAC have made it easier than ever for candidates to solicit donations from supporters, and social media platforms like Facebook and Twitter provide a way to reach a wider audience.

Another trend is the emphasis on transparency and accountability in fundraising efforts. Donors want to know how their money is being spent and what impact it is having on the campaign. Many candidates now provide regular updates on their fundraising progress and how the money is being used, increasing trust and encouraging more donations.

Peer-to-peer fundraising is also becoming more popular in political campaigns. This involves recruiting supporters to raise money on behalf of the candidate, either through individual fundraising pages or by organizing events like house parties or phone banks. This not only helps raise more money but also increases engagement and builds a sense of community among supporters.

We are also seeing a move towards recurring donations in grassroots fundraising initiatives. Rather than relying on one-time donations, many campaigns now encourage supporters to set up monthly or quarterly donations, providing a more stable source of income and reducing the pressure to constantly solicit new donors.

Additionally, there is a growing trend towards personalized fundraising appeals. Candidates are using data and analytics to tailor their fundraising messages to individual donors, making them more relevant and compelling. This can result in higher donation rates and increased loyalty from supporters.

Overall, grassroots fundraising initiatives for political campaigns are evolving to adapt to changing technology and donor preferences. By leveraging online platforms, emphasizing transparency and accountability, encouraging peer-to-peer fundraising, promoting recurring donations, and personalizing fundraising appeals, campaigns can maximize their fundraising efforts and build a strong base of support.
